Trump’s blockbuster tariffs threaten Queensland’s booming film industry

US President Donald Trump’s move to slap a 100 per cent tariff on foreign-made films has sent shockwaves through Queensland’s booming screen sector — putting hundreds of millions in investment, thousands of local jobs, and Australia’s “Hollywood 2.0” reputation at risk.
